About Samaul

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Samaul village is 220465. Samaul village is located in Madhubani subdivision of Madhubani district in Bihar, India. It is situated 14km away from Madhubani, which is both district & sub-district headquarter of Samaul village. As per 2009 stats, Sonaur is the gram panchayat of Samaul village.

The total geographical area of village is 164.6 hectares. Samaul has a total population of 2,826 peoples, out of which male population is 1,480 while female population is 1,346. Literacy rate of samaul village is 62.74% out of which 71.01% males and 53.64% females are literate. There are about 564 houses in samaul village. Pincode of samaul village locality is 847234.

Madhubani is nearest town to samaul for all major economic activities, which is approximately 8km away.

Population of Samaul

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 2,826 1,480 1,346
Literate Population 1,773 1,051 722
Illiterate Population 1,053 429 624
